The environmental credentials of motor retailers will be coming under increased scrutiny in the years ahead.
Investment in sustainable energy use and carbon reduction needs to be taking place now, to help manage the rising costs of operating showrooms as well as taking action on carbon footprint.
In this webinar, brought to you by Automotive Management, our panel of guests shared insights into the steps dealer groups can take now and in the next few years to become environmentally sustainable, and the marketing opportunities that are incidental to their efforts.
